JOYCE, James

Ulysses

First Edition. Small quarto. Original blue wrappers titled in white. Bookplate on the first leaf, the spine and the edges of the wrappers have been beautifully and expertly restored, thus near fine. Housed in half blue calf solander box. This is one of 750 copies printed on handmade paper, of a total edition of 1000 copies. Possibly the magnum opus of the 20th Century, and certainly one of the most important modern novels, this stream-of-consciousness epic routinely tops lists of great books. Beginning in 1918 episodes of this novel were published in the American Little Review, until it was banned in 1920. On publication copies of the book had to be smuggled into the United States, often with the aid of rebinding. All copies of the first edition are desirable, those in original wraps particularly so. Connolly 100.
